FV Hospital, now equipped with the Storz Modulith SLK – a latest generation of lithotripter and offers 30% discount for lithotripter packages

FV Hospital, now equipped with the Storz Modulith SLK – a latest generation of lithotripter and offers 30% discount for lithotripter packages

Patients with nephrolithiasis, ureteral stones and bladder stones can now benefit from treatment with the latest generation of lithotripter, the German-manufactured Storz Modulith SLK, at FV Hospital’s Urology Department. From February 5 to March 30, 2018, FV will offer a discount of 30% on the cost of crushing stones via the skin using this technology – an effective, painless form of treatment which helps patients to save money when compared to other traditional forms of treatment.

Series of theme Facing Death – Part 12: Dr. Louis Brasseur: Being humble to listen to patients

Series of theme Facing Death – Part 12: Dr. Louis Brasseur: Being humble to listen to patients

Dr. Louis Brasseur is a leading pain management specialist in France. His whole life has been connected with this homeland as he graduated from a medical university and received intensive training in France. He had 40 years working in many hospitals across France including being the Director of Pain Management and Inserm Research Unit (Hospital Ambroise Pare) for many years, as well as Director of Pain Management & Supportive Care Unit, René Huguenin Hospital (Curie cancer group), and Director of Pain Management Centre (Anaesthesiology Department) at Bichat Hospital, all units located in Paris area.

Heart Failure – Symptoms, Diagnosis and Treatment

Heart Failure – Symptoms, Diagnosis and Treatment

According to WHO, cardiovascular diseases are the leading cause of death for all people worldwide. Every year, the number of people die from heart disease and stroke is more than the total number of people die from cancer, tuberculosis, malaria and HIV.

What is the leading cause of death in people with heart diseases?

What is the leading cause of death in people with heart diseases?

Myocardial ischemia or myocardial infarction can damage the heart, reducing the heart's pumping function and causing fatal cardiac arrhythmias. If the coronary artery is completely blocked, it will cause a heart attack. This is viewed as the leading cause of death in patients with cardiovascular diseases.
